Best way to ship something from Taobao to Canada?

Hello

I was looking into DXRacer chairs(Around $270-330 here) and found out that in Taobao they are dirt cheap(Some low as 60 dollars). I tried using the Taobao agents that offer international shipping, normally this wouldn't be a problem but the DXracer chairs weigh about 25 kg which translate to really, really high shipping costs according to the shipping calculator most taobao agents use; additional cost per kg(Shipping average around $400 from the 4 taobao agents I used). They all seem to use EMS, DHL or Air mail which have similar pricing. Is there any cheap option to ship from China? since I don't believe the minimum to ship a 25 kg box is 400 dollars; if not then I guess I can just order from the American site or Costco. Unless someone knows a far better chair.

over 20kg, the shipping would be about USD $5/kg ($17 for the first kg), below 20kg about twice that - that's freight - it will take about a month to arrive. quoting that from experience. ordered 23kg package from china early 2014 - paid $105.
